A Guide to Camera Shutter Designs: Focal-Plane, Leaf, and the Rest To take a photograph is to encapsulate a singular moment in time and space in the form of an image. In order to do that, no matter what kind of equipment we are using, we need a sort of tool to divide the past and future from the singular present, the precise moment that we wish to capture - no matter how long or how fleeting it might be.
